The cheapest way to get from Londonderry to Sligo is to bus which costs €20 - €28 and takes 2h 35m.
The fastest way to get from Londonderry to Sligo is to drive which takes 1h 46m and costs €23 - €35.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Ulsterbus Depot and arriving at Sligo Bus Stn. Services depart every four hours,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 2h 35m.
The distance between Londonderry and Sligo is 144 km. The road distance is 130.6 km.
The best way to get from Londonderry to Sligo without a car is to bus which takes 2h 35m and costs €20 - €28.
The bus from Ulsterbus Depot to Sligo Bus Stn takes 2h 35m including transfers and departs every four hours.
Londonderry to Sligo bus services, operated by Expressway (Bus Éireann), depart from Ulsterbus Depot station.
Londonderry to Sligo bus services, operated by Expressway (Bus Éireann), arrive at Sligo Bus Stn station.
Yes, the driving distance between Londonderry to Sligo is 131 km. It takes approximately 1h 46m to drive from Londonderry to Sligo.
